Ossington Avenue Rental Conversion in Toronto

Converting a Duplex Used as a Single-Family Home Into Three Income-Producing Rental Units

416 Construction completed a full rental conversion and renovation of an existing residential property on Ossington Avenue in Toronto.

Although the property had originally been configured as a duplex, it was being used as a single-family residence when the project began. Our team redesigned and renovated the building to create three functional rental suites while improving the property’s building systems, safety features, layouts and long-term income potential.

The completed property included:

  • A basement 1-bedroom-plus-den suite

  • A ground-floor 1-bedroom-plus-den suite

  • An upper-level 3-bedroom-plus-den suite

  • A shared landscaped backyard

  • A shared garden area

  • Improved electrical, heating and life-safety systems

  • Updated kitchens, bathrooms and living spaces

The three units achieved combined gross monthly rent of approximately $6,850, or approximately $82,200 in annual gross rental income.
